Actually, nothing. To bring a corporation into existence, you submit your Articles of Incorporation with the government agency responsible for processing that paperwork in your state. By submitting the Articles, or “Charter Documents”, and the act by the agency of approving same, you have formed a corporation. You can say “file” if you want.
